## Runbook: Gaugepile Sidecar — Release Checklist

Heads up: the sidecar ships with every app pod, so a bad config fans out fast. Before cutting a release, confirm the flush interval hasn't drifted from what the Tallyhouse aggregator expects, or you'll see sawtooth gaps in dashboards. Rollbacks are cheap — just repin the image tag. Canary one node pool first, watch for ten minutes, then proceed. The values to verify against are these.

config for bagep-yafof:
quenath:
  pin: 8584
  metrics_host: metrics.quenath.tolvaqsys.internal
  tenant: pelath
  seal: seal_ed102645

Handover Note — Director to Director

To branch managers and Imra Voss: the Kestrel Ledger rollout is now eight weeks behind. Root causes: vendor delays from Tannwick Labs and under-scoped data migration. Halden branch pilot holds at phase two; do not expand. Budget remains fixed; overruns need my sign-off until handover completes. Imra takes ownership from Monday. Weekly status calls continue unchanged. All escalations route through her office. One sensitive item follows for directors only.

management briefing: Rusathek Logistics plans to lower the Oliir list price by 35.0 percent in July. The board signed off on a budget of $225.5 million for Project Ulador. The renewal with Quenaxix Foods closes at $345.9 million a year, 30.3 percent above the last contract. Project Quenius slips by two quarters because of the staffing delay.

Hi Marta — quick handover before I'm off. The uniform order for the new Quarry Vale depot is mostly sorted. Fenwick Garments will ship two pallets early next week; the hi-vis vests come separately. I've flagged the sizing issue with the jackets, so expect a few swaps. Invoices go to Derren in accounts as usual. One thing left: when the courier arrives for the sample crate, tell them exactly this:

dispatch memo: the eliath belael courier leaves the praox ledger at gate 8841 under passcode 017589

## Deploying the Gatewick Proctor Queue

Deploys are pretty painless: push to main, wait for the pipeline, then watch the queue drain dashboard for five minutes. If candidates pile up mid-exam, roll back first and ask questions later — the queue replays safely. Everything the workers care about lives in one config block, shown here for reference.

settings of bafof-yagef:
JOROX_PIN=8740
JOROX_TENANT=pelox
JOROX_METRICS_HOST=metrics.jorox.qorvelworks.internal
JOROX_SEAL=seal_c78f63c1
JOROX_STANDBY_TEAM=norax